Borr Drilling Announces Bruno Morand To Become CEO Effective September 1, 2025

  • Borr financing package to increase liquidity by $200 million, strengthening balance sheet for continued growth
  • Bruno Morand to become CEO effective September 1, 2025, following a thorough succession planning process
  • Patrick Schorn to transition from CEO to Executive Chairman of the Board of Directors, providing continuity and expanded leadership bandwidth, with the current Chairman to remain as a Director

HAMILTON, Bermuda, July 2, 2025 /PRNewswire/ -- Borr Drilling Limited (NYSE:BORR, ", Borr", , ", Borr Drilling", or the ", Company", ))) has announced today that the Company has received commitments from certain commercial banks to: 1) increase existing super senior RCF (SSRCF) to $200 million; 2) reallocate the existing $45 million Guarantee Facility from super senior to senior secured (freeing up $45 million of capacity under the SSRCF);  and 3) add a new $35 million senior secured RCF, subject to a $100 million equity raise. Additionally, the Company has obtained more favorable terms on the financial covenants in these facilities, including a reduction in the minimum liquidity covenant.

The changes to the facilities, together with a proposed $100 million equity raise separately announced by the Company, are expected to increase the Company's available liquidity by more than $200 million. Together, these moves would strengthen the Company's financial position in order to support continued execution of its long-term strategy as well as the pursuit of potential value-added growth opportunities and industry consolidation.

Borr also announces today that pursuant to the Company's multi-year succession planning process, the Board of Directors has reached a unanimous decision to appoint Mr. Bruno Morand as successor to Chief Executive Officer, Mr. Patrick Schorn, effective September 1, 2025.

At the time of the transition, Mr. Schorn will become Executive Chairman of the Company's Board of Directors, while current Chairman Mr. Tor Olav Trøim will continue to serve as a Director of the Board. Additionally, current Director Mr. Dan Rabun (former Chief Executive Officer and Chairman at Ensco plc) will become Lead Independent Director, ensuring the continuity of independent and objective leadership on behalf of Borr Drilling's shareholders.
